QT400-10 nodular cast iron requires hardness of HRC47~51. Why can't quench hardness be reached?

QT400-10 nodular cast iron requires hardness of HRC47~51. Why can't quench hardness be reached?

Answer:

Because of the high tempering stability of the nodular iron, the tempering temperature is 400-450 degrees, and the tempering time is 1 hours.
Quenching temperature: when the silicon content of nodular cast iron is 2.0-3.0%, the quenching temperature is 860-900 DEG C, the silicon content is low, and the upper limit is taken when the lower limit is high.2. holding time: because of the consideration of diffusion graphite cast iron, alloy steel is therefore the holding time, holding time longer than carbon steel.3. oil quenching.
QT400-10 shall ensure sufficient pearlite in the casting state, at least half of the pearlite. This is done with the temperature, time, and water. But if it is big, the heart hardness will not go up.
